If (2p – 1), 7, 3p are in AP, find the value of p.

Sum
Advertisements

Solution

Let (2p-1) ,7 and 3p be three consecutive terms of an AP.

Then 7 - (2p -1) = 3p -7

⇒ 5 p = 15

⇒ p= 3

∴ When p =3,(2p -1), 7and 3p form three consecutive terms of an AP.
